My passion for food began when I started cooking as a little girl growing up in San German, Puerto Rico. My mother worked, and I had a baby-sitter who showed me how to cook, and pick herbs and vegetables straight out of the garden. I also learned about life on a farm, and saw where great ingredients came from.
A product of both Puerto Rican and African-American heritage, I spent summers on the Lower East Side of New York City where I learned the basics of Cuchifrito and Soul Food cooking. My love for Latin Soul cuisine was born-- the best of both worlds!
Cooking was so fun and satisfying that as I got older I began cooking for my friends and family, and hosting elaborate dinner parties. In 2004, I really started to hone in on my talent. I spent some time in culinary school learning new techniques and trying different recipes—I’ve even created some of my own!
I worked in the corporate world for over eight years, and even though my time there was invaluable, I wanted to be more creative. In 2009, I began my own business. I worked a full-time job, and catered small parties on the weekends. I did all of the shopping and cooking myself, and still do. I shop for quality and fresh ingredients in order to provide my clients with a quality product.
